What Is A Hfnc Systems?

High-Flow Nasal Cannula (HFNC) systems represent an advanced respiratory support modality widely adopted in clinical settings across Tunisia. These systems deliver a precisely controlled blend of heated and humidified air and oxygen at high flow rates, typically ranging from 10 to 60 liters per minute, through a specialized nasal cannula. Unlike traditional low-flow oxygen therapy, HFNC systems create a positive airway pressure, effectively ventilating the upper airway and improving oxygenation and ventilation in patients with respiratory distress. The heated and humidified gas mixture enhances patient comfort, reduces airway resistance, and promotes mucociliary clearance, thereby minimizing airway irritation and the risk of endotracheal tube reinsertion.

FeatureBenefit
High Flow Rates (10-60 L/min)Effective alveolar recruitment and improved gas exchange.
Humidification and HeatingEnhanced patient comfort, reduced airway irritation, and improved mucociliary function.
Positive Airway Pressure (PEEP-like effect)Reduces work of breathing and prevents airway collapse.

Key Clinical Applications of HFNC Systems:

  • Acute hypoxemic respiratory failure in adults and children.
  • Post-extubation respiratory support to prevent reintubation.
  • Management of moderate to severe dyspnea.
  • Adjunct therapy in sepsis and shock.
  • Support for patients undergoing certain surgical procedures.

How Much Is A Hfnc Systems In Tunisia?

The investment in High-Flow Nasal Cannula (HFNC) systems in Tunisia can vary significantly based on several factors, including the brand, model, specific features, and whether the unit is new or refurbished. Understanding these price ranges is crucial for healthcare facilities to budget effectively for this vital respiratory support technology.

Generally, new HFNC systems in Tunisia can range from approximately 15,000 TND to 40,000 TND or more. This broad spectrum reflects the differences in advanced functionalities, patient monitoring capabilities, and integrated humidification systems offered by various manufacturers. Top-tier models with comprehensive features and enhanced performance will naturally command higher prices.

For facilities with tighter budgets, refurbished HFNC systems present a more economical option. These units, which have been previously used but are professionally restored to full working order, typically fall within the range of 8,000 TND to 25,000 TND. It is essential to ensure that refurbished equipment comes with a warranty and has undergone rigorous quality checks to guarantee reliability and patient safety.
